n1474335
c0f003b450
Merge branch 'Luhn' of https://github.com/n1073645/CyberChef into n1073645-Luhn
2020-03-05 15:16:50 +00:00
n1073645
940b56ba5f
Luhn Checksum Operation Added
2020-02-26 10:55:15 +00:00
n1073645
8f2a1f5b2c
Improved email regex
2020-02-25 14:48:22 +00:00
n1474335
b045dc37f5
Tidied up infoURL in Rail Fence Cipher ops
2020-02-13 15:06:09 +00:00
n1474335
015d0f065f
Merge branch 'master' of https://github.com/Flavsditz/CyberChef into Flavsditz-master
2020-02-13 15:04:00 +00:00
n1474335
c2212f9ab3
Tidied up To Hex mods
2020-02-13 14:17:43 +00:00
Flavio Diez
0ab96dd4ca
Throw OperationError instead of returning a String
2020-01-29 14:16:04 +01:00
Flavio Diez
1509b2b96c
Implemented the Rail Fence Cipher with both encoding and decoding
2020-01-29 12:46:38 +01:00
Andy Wang
293a95e938
Remove tickbox and make 0x comma an option
2020-01-18 13:55:32 +00:00
Andy Wang
23956480b7
Variable name
2020-01-17 18:47:46 +00:00
Andy Wang
6dbaf6a36c
reverse highlight
2020-01-17 12:48:21 +00:00
Andy Wang
1d8c7dcb97
Allow output highlighting
2020-01-15 23:29:18 +00:00
Andy Wang
597fba2fd0
Add line size formatting and comma separation
2020-01-15 00:14:43 +00:00
n1474335
23a228bbd9
Tidied up Normalise Unicode operation
2019-12-20 16:05:24 +00:00
n1474335
598813ff88
Merge branch 'normalise-unicode' of https://github.com/matthieuxyz/CyberChef into matthieuxyz-normalise-unicode
2019-12-20 15:56:59 +00:00
n1474335
bf0bd620f1
Tidied up Case Insensitive Regex ops
2019-12-20 15:54:39 +00:00
n1474335
62edd76d7e
Merge branch 'dev' of https://github.com/n1073645/CyberChef into n1073645-dev
2019-12-20 15:49:40 +00:00
n1073645
72ba579e1e
Remove unnecessary comments.
2019-12-17 12:17:13 +00:00
n1073645
5fd2512a9b
Gzip tests added
2019-12-17 12:15:11 +00:00
n1073645
3a1a6a94d2
Sets the gzip comment bitfield
2019-12-16 17:05:06 +00:00
n1474335
61e6423d95
Added word separator code to Morse Code ops.
2019-12-02 15:17:17 +00:00
Matthieu
a6fa0628f2
Add operation to normalise unicode
2019-11-25 22:59:14 +01:00
Mirclus
8e5aa2c393
DNS over HTTP: Fix "validate" argument
...
The argument sets the "cd" parameter on the request.
For both included providers, this flag disables validation ([1], [2]),
so doing the exact opposite of the described action.
This changes the label to the correct name and also flips the default
value to keep the old behavior.
[1] Google
<https://developers.google.com/speed/public-dns/docs/doh/json#supported_parameters >
[2] Cloudflare
<https://developers.cloudflare.com/1.1.1.1/dns-over-https/json-format/ >
2019-11-25 20:08:30 +01:00
n1073645
81d1007bb7
Added tests for regex operation and a slight bug fix
2019-11-22 10:45:02 +00:00
n1073645
04036e001e
Comments and linting for regex operation.
2019-11-21 12:13:34 +00:00
n1073645
c60ed2c403
Linting on regex operation
2019-11-21 09:56:52 +00:00
n1073645
7d41d4d030
Replaced the .replaces in regex operation
2019-11-21 09:11:12 +00:00
n1073645
6d77fe6eb3
Combined two rules into one case insensitive rule
2019-11-20 09:28:34 +00:00
n1073645
40d3c8b071
ToCaseInsensitiveRegex improvements
2019-11-18 13:31:19 +00:00
n1073645
02ec4a3bfd
ToCaseInsensitiveRegex improvements
2019-11-18 13:21:05 +00:00
n1073645
30c6917914
Merge remote-tracking branch 'upstream/master'
2019-11-14 09:03:06 +00:00
n1073645
33464b3388
Linting changes
2019-11-14 08:55:27 +00:00
n1474335
2c40353180
Merge branch 'node12filenames' of https://github.com/janisozaur/CyberChef into janisozaur-node12filenames
2019-11-13 18:05:55 +00:00
n1474335
cce84c3782
Fixed bug in Base62 operations when using different alphabets
2019-11-13 17:59:16 +00:00
Michał Janiszewski
69c6c3e790
Add missing filenames for Node 12 imports
2019-11-12 23:43:16 +01:00
n1474335
875c1019b2
Merge branch 'blowfish-fix' of https://github.com/cbeuw/CyberChef into cbeuw-blowfish-fix
2019-11-06 13:22:50 +00:00
n1474335
fdfbf7ddf8
Merge branch 'master' of https://github.com/dkarpo/CyberChef into dkarpo-master
2019-11-06 13:20:41 +00:00
n1474335
414f8b5ba9
Added link to Lorenz wiki article in operation description
2019-11-06 13:17:44 +00:00
Derrick Karpo
03a1c566fc
Add file extensions which are mandatory for the latest Node 12.x.
...
Note: This doesn't solve the upstream import's which still don't
comply but it preps CyberChef for it.
2019-11-06 06:01:52 -07:00
n1474335
9ed2b26933
Tidied up Lorenz operation and created new Bletchley module for WW2-era ciphers
2019-11-06 12:14:22 +00:00
n1474335
70665534b8
Merge branch 'master' of https://github.com/VirtualColossus/CyberChef
2019-11-06 12:00:37 +00:00
n1474335
e1378860d6
Added support for 109 more character encodings
2019-11-01 14:56:18 +00:00
VirtualColossus
b9571db9f1
Merge branch 'master' into master
2019-10-31 15:33:54 +00:00
n1474335
daad633195
Tidied up Avro to JSON operation
2019-10-31 14:17:07 +00:00
n1474335
a2c46b3f66
Merge branch 'avro-to-json' of https://github.com/jarrodconnolly/CyberChef into jarrodconnolly-avro-to-json
2019-10-31 13:54:00 +00:00
VirtualColossus
c0e02451a1
Fixed bug using KT option, added tests
2019-10-31 07:28:33 +00:00
Jarrod Connolly
2d12a16771
Add Avro to JSON data format conversion
2019-10-30 22:09:42 -07:00
Gustavo Silva
9108b3923b
diff.mjs: Fixes tests and adds default flag
...
* Sets default flag to `false` for `showSubtraction` flag.
* Removes extra span for else case that was causing some tests to
fail. Moreover, the previous behavior was defined as that.
* Adds custom test for the showSubtraction option, both using the
`showAdded` and `showRemoved` flags.
2019-10-29 23:39:14 +00:00
Gustavo Silva
726e117656
diff.mjs: Allows showing subtraction
...
Adds "Show Subtraction" button to allow seeing only the difference
between two texts.
When selected and combined, user can see only the characters or
words that were added. If not combined, with either removed or added
but selected, then nothing is displayed.
2019-10-29 23:12:24 +00:00
VirtualColossus
55eae9910f
Tidied run function, added some tests
2019-10-29 21:39:29 +00:00